Block

#21,555,203
Block Number
21,555,203 @ 05/01/2025, 06:33:10
Status
Finalized
ID
0x0148e803eb12aac310c99cb4c0b1099a1fa1fda220b92b87b88823f74724d945
Transactions
Gas Used
2922369/40000000 (7.31% Used)
Total Score
2,104,982,421 (+99)
Rewards
10.18 VTHO